Re: Siri freezing when using voiceover

2012-08-19 Thread Mari
Is pressing the home button 5 times really a safe option what are some 
other solutions that anyone has? also what is re-spring? 
 

On Sunday, August 19, 2012 9:11:39 PM UTC-7, Joshua wrote:

> Hello.  As far as I know, pressing the power button five times to 
> respring is quite safe.  I have done it several times, and have 
> never had a problem.  Also, its a lot quicker than rebooting the 
> device. 
> Another tip: You can also restart your springboard using siri.   
> To do this, just start Siri and say "restart." Obviously, this 
> won't work if siri is frozen, but I figured some people may find 
> this interesting. 
> Josh
